Built motion from commit da24aabd.|2.6.20
[motion2.git] / server / api / userProfileResource / userProfileResource.rpc.js
index d5950fe..bc198a0 100644 (file)
@@ -15,4 +15,4 @@
 // * treaties. The SOFTWARE PRODUCT is licensed, not sold.                        *
 // *                                                                       *
 // *************************************************************************
-var _0xbb35=['../../config/logger','rpc','../../config/environment','jayson/promise','http','request','UserProfileResource,\x20%s,\x20%s','request\x20sent','UserProfileResource,\x20%s,\x20%s,\x20%s','error','code','message','result','catch','lodash','util','bluebird','randomstring','ioredis'];(function(_0x57813e,_0xf4ffc3){var _0x35103d=function(_0x35b68d){while(--_0x35b68d){_0x57813e['push'](_0x57813e['shift']());}};_0x35103d(++_0xf4ffc3);}(_0xbb35,0x1c3));var _0x5bb3=function(_0x3b10bf,_0x116af5){_0x3b10bf=_0x3b10bf-0x0;var _0x36bb08=_0xbb35[_0x3b10bf];return _0x36bb08;};'use strict';var _=require(_0x5bb3('0x0'));var util=require(_0x5bb3('0x1'));var moment=require('moment');var BPromise=require(_0x5bb3('0x2'));var rs=require(_0x5bb3('0x3'));var fs=require('fs');var Redis=require(_0x5bb3('0x4'));var db=require('../../mysqldb')['db'];var utils=require('../../config/utils');var logger=require(_0x5bb3('0x5'))(_0x5bb3('0x6'));var config=require(_0x5bb3('0x7'));var jayson=require(_0x5bb3('0x8'));var client=jayson['client'][_0x5bb3('0x9')]({'port':0x232a});function respondWithRpcPromise(_0x47ab44,_0x1ba3c9,_0x340042){return new BPromise(function(_0x341d05,_0x31e06d){return client[_0x5bb3('0xa')](_0x47ab44,_0x340042)['then'](function(_0x26c8ee){logger['info'](_0x5bb3('0xb'),_0x1ba3c9,_0x5bb3('0xc'));logger['debug'](_0x5bb3('0xd'),_0x1ba3c9,_0x5bb3('0xc'),JSON['stringify'](_0x26c8ee));if(_0x26c8ee[_0x5bb3('0xe')]){if(_0x26c8ee[_0x5bb3('0xe')][_0x5bb3('0xf')]===0x1f4){logger[_0x5bb3('0xe')](_0x5bb3('0xb'),_0x1ba3c9,_0x26c8ee[_0x5bb3('0xe')][_0x5bb3('0x10')]);return _0x31e06d(_0x26c8ee['error'][_0x5bb3('0x10')]);}logger[_0x5bb3('0xe')](_0x5bb3('0xb'),_0x1ba3c9,_0x26c8ee['error']['message']);return _0x341d05(_0x26c8ee[_0x5bb3('0xe')][_0x5bb3('0x10')]);}else{logger['info'](_0x5bb3('0xb'),_0x1ba3c9,_0x5bb3('0xc'));_0x341d05(_0x26c8ee[_0x5bb3('0x11')][_0x5bb3('0x10')]);}})[_0x5bb3('0x12')](function(_0x1b36f3){logger[_0x5bb3('0xe')](_0x5bb3('0xb'),_0x1ba3c9,_0x1b36f3);_0x31e06d(_0x1b36f3);});});}
\ No newline at end of file
+var _0x88a2=['ioredis','../../mysqldb','rpc','../../config/environment','jayson/promise','client','request','then','info','UserProfileResource,\x20%s,\x20%s','request\x20sent','debug','UserProfileResource,\x20%s,\x20%s,\x20%s','error','message','result','catch','util','bluebird','randomstring'];(function(_0x4f0e62,_0x28e44f){var _0x117ab8=function(_0x1a74bb){while(--_0x1a74bb){_0x4f0e62['push'](_0x4f0e62['shift']());}};_0x117ab8(++_0x28e44f);}(_0x88a2,0x9d));var _0x288a=function(_0x310463,_0x7e69a1){_0x310463=_0x310463-0x0;var _0x32f582=_0x88a2[_0x310463];return _0x32f582;};'use strict';var _=require('lodash');var util=require(_0x288a('0x0'));var moment=require('moment');var BPromise=require(_0x288a('0x1'));var rs=require(_0x288a('0x2'));var fs=require('fs');var Redis=require(_0x288a('0x3'));var db=require(_0x288a('0x4'))['db'];var utils=require('../../config/utils');var logger=require('../../config/logger')(_0x288a('0x5'));var config=require(_0x288a('0x6'));var jayson=require(_0x288a('0x7'));var client=jayson[_0x288a('0x8')]['http']({'port':0x232a});function respondWithRpcPromise(_0x40dc91,_0x85d235,_0x3ca42f){return new BPromise(function(_0x334e4c,_0x3e5fa2){return client[_0x288a('0x9')](_0x40dc91,_0x3ca42f)[_0x288a('0xa')](function(_0x6730e1){logger[_0x288a('0xb')](_0x288a('0xc'),_0x85d235,_0x288a('0xd'));logger[_0x288a('0xe')](_0x288a('0xf'),_0x85d235,'request\x20sent',JSON['stringify'](_0x6730e1));if(_0x6730e1[_0x288a('0x10')]){if(_0x6730e1[_0x288a('0x10')]['code']===0x1f4){logger['error'](_0x288a('0xc'),_0x85d235,_0x6730e1['error'][_0x288a('0x11')]);return _0x3e5fa2(_0x6730e1[_0x288a('0x10')][_0x288a('0x11')]);}logger[_0x288a('0x10')](_0x288a('0xc'),_0x85d235,_0x6730e1[_0x288a('0x10')][_0x288a('0x11')]);return _0x334e4c(_0x6730e1[_0x288a('0x10')][_0x288a('0x11')]);}else{logger[_0x288a('0xb')](_0x288a('0xc'),_0x85d235,_0x288a('0xd'));_0x334e4c(_0x6730e1[_0x288a('0x12')]['message']);}})[_0x288a('0x13')](function(_0x2094ba){logger['error'](_0x288a('0xc'),_0x85d235,_0x2094ba);_0x3e5fa2(_0x2094ba);});});}
\ No newline at end of file